Franciskao is a masculine name derived from the Latin name Franciscus, meaning 'Frenchman' or 'free man.' It combines the root related to the Franks, a Germanic tribe, with a unique suffix 'kao,' possibly modern or invented, giving it a distinct flair. Historically, the name is linked to Saint Francis of Assisi, symbolizing freedom and humility.

Cultural Significance of Franciskao

The root name Franciscus traces back to the Franks, a Germanic people whose name means 'free.' It has deep Christian significance due to Saint Francis of Assisi, revered for his humility and love for nature. Though Franciskao is a modern or less common variant, it carries this rich legacy of freedom and spiritual grace, blending traditional roots with contemporary uniqueness.
